XCreateRegion(3) XLIB FUNCTIONS XCreateRegion(3)
NAME
XCreateRegion, XSetRegion, XDestroyRegion - create or
destroy regions
SYNTAX
Region XCreateRegion(void);
int XSetRegion(Display *display, GC gc, Region r);
int XDestroyRegion(Region r);
ARGUMENTS
display Specifies the connection to the X server.
gc Specifies the GC.
r Specifies the region.
DESCRIPTION
The XCreateRegion function creates a new empty region.
The XSetRegion function sets the clip-mask in the GC to
the specified region. The region is specified relative to
the drawable's origin. The resulting GC clip origin is
implementation-dependent. Once it is set in the GC, the
region can be destroyed.
The XDestroyRegion function deallocates the storage asso-
ciated with a specified region.
